Core i5-3470 outperforms Core i5-2500 by 13% in our combined benchmark results. PassmarkPassm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ance. Benchmark coverage: 67% Core i5-3470 outperforms Core i5-2500 by 13% in Passmark. GeekBench 5 Single-CoreGeekBench 5 Single-Core is a cross-platform application developed in the form of CPU tests that independently recreate certain real-world tasks with which to accurately measure performance. This version uses only a single CPU core. Benchmark coverage: 40% Core i5-3470 outperforms Core i5-2500 by 6% in GeekBench 5 Single-Core.
